Steel coil contusion refers to the damage such as depression and bulge on the surface of steel coil caused by external force during production, transportation or use. These contusions not only affect the appearance quality of the steel coil, but may also have an adverse effect on its performance. Therefore, it is very important to repair steel coil contusion in time. The following are several common methods for repairing steel coil contusion:
1. Welding repair
Principle:
Welding repair is to reconnect the steel coil into a whole by welding filler metal at the contusion.
Advantages:
- Easy operation
- Obvious effect
Disadvantages:
- Causes a certain degree of damage to the surface of the steel coil
Scope of application:
Applicable to some obvious surface defects such as cracks, folds, etc.
2. Laser cladding repair
Principle:
Laser cladding repair is a repair method that uses a high-energy laser beam to quickly melt and solidify the coating material and the substrate surface.
Advantages:
- Metallurgical bonding between the repair layer and the substrate
- Rapid in-situ repair can be achieved
Disadvantages:
- High equipment cost
- High technical requirements for operation
Scope of application:
Applicable to repair problems such as wear and corrosion on the surface of steel coils.
3. Heat treatment repair
Principle:
Heat treatment repair is to improve or eliminate the bruise by adjusting the phase change process inside the steel coil.
Advantages:
- Improve the overall performance of the steel coil
Disadvantages:
- Complex operation
- High cost
Scope of application:
Applicable to some deep defects, such as internal holes, inclusions, etc.
4. Cold correction
Principle:
Cold correction is to correct the steel coil by mechanical force to restore it to its original shape.
Advantages:
- No additional damage to the surface of the steel coil
- Relatively simple operation
Disadvantages:
- Limited effect on severe bruises
Scope of application:
Applicable to some minor surface bruises.
5. Chemical treatment
Principle:
Chemical treatment is to treat the surface of the steel coil with chemical reagents to remove oxides, impurities, etc. at the contusion, and then repair the surface.
Advantages:
- It can remove oxides, impurities, etc. on the surface
- It helps to improve the repair effect
Disadvantages:
- Chemical reagents may pollute the environment
- Improper operation may cause damage to the surface of the steel coil
Scope of application:
Applicable to some steel coils with severe surface contusions.
6. Surface coating repair
Principle:
Surface coating repair is to spray a layer of protective coating on the contusion to cover up defects and improve the corrosion resistance of the steel coil.
Advantages:
- Easy operation
- It can improve the corrosion resistance of the steel coil
Disadvantages:
- The coating may fall off over time
Scope of application:
Applicable to some steel coils with mild surface contusions.
Conclusion
There are many ways to repair steel coil contusions. The specific method should be determined according to the severity and location of the contusion and the use requirements of the steel coil. In actual operation, a combination of multiple methods can be used for comprehensive repair to achieve the best repair effect. At the same time, attention should be paid to strengthening quality control in the production process to prevent the occurrence of contusions, thereby improving the overall quality and service life of the steel coil.
